§ 26.1-29-17 — Materiality of matters - How determined
Materiality is to be determined not by the event, but solely by the probable and reasonable
influence of the facts upon the party to whom the communication is due in forming the party's
estimate of the disadvantages of the proposed contract or in making the party's inquiries.
